Alpha by Public is an AI-powered investment research platform developed by the fintech company Public.com. It is designed to democratize access to sophisticated market analysis, offering retail investors the kind of data-driven insights and signals that were once the exclusive domain of professional traders and institutions. The core value lies in its ability to process vast amounts of market data, news, and financial reports to deliver clear, actionable intelligence, helping users make more informed investment decisions without requiring deep financial expertise.
Key features include the generation of real-time buy, sell, and hold signals for individual stocks based on AI analysis of market sentiment and fundamentals. It offers detailed stock report cards that summarize key metrics, risks, and growth potential in an easily digestible format. The platform provides daily market briefings and curated news feeds tailored to a user's watchlist, highlighting events that could impact their holdings. Additionally, it features proprietary indicators like the Alpha Score, which quantifies a stock's momentum and strength, and allows for backtesting investment strategies against historical data to evaluate potential performance.
What sets Alpha apart is its tight integration with the Public.com brokerage ecosystem, allowing users to seamlessly move from research to execution within a single, user-friendly mobile app. The AI models are specifically tuned for the public markets, analyzing unconventional data sources alongside traditional financial metrics. It operates primarily as a mobile application for iOS and Android, ensuring accessibility. The tool's uniqueness stems from its educational focus, explaining the reasoning behind its signals to help users learn about market dynamics, rather than offering a opaque black-box solution.
Ideal for self-directed retail investors and traders seeking an edge in the stock market without paying for expensive professional services. It is particularly useful for beginners who need guidance in parsing complex financial information, as well as for more experienced investors looking for a consolidated source of signals and data to validate their own research. Specific use cases include quickly assessing the health of a potential investment, receiving alerts on significant news affecting a portfolio, and discovering new trading opportunities based on algorithmic screening of market conditions.
